New York hotel joins Autograph Collection
Marriott International's Autograph Collection has announced that The Carlton Hotel, a 317-bedroom hotel in New York City, US, has become the latest addition to its portfolio.
The property has recently undergone a multi-million dollar renovation overseen by architect David Rockwell of The Rockwell Group and is managed by Gemstone Hotels and Resorts.
Facilities include an 800sq ft (74sq m) fitness centre offering cardiovascular and resistance machines; a lobby bar; and the signature, full-service Murray Hill restaurant, Millesime.
First unveiled in 1904 as the Hotel Seville, the property was initially designed by Harry Allen Jacobs in Beaux-Arts-style architecture and featured Art Nouveau-inspired interiors.
Hotel general manager Victor Freeman said: "With our rich New York history and reputation for exceptional service and commitment to our guests, we are confident this will be a successful partnership."
Kip Vreeland, vice president for the Autograph Collection, added: "The Carlton Hotel is an ideal addition to our portfolio, as it is effortlessly aligned with the Autograph Collection's mission to provide original and unparalleled travel experiences."
The Carlton Hotel is the 27th property to join the expanding Autograph Collection, with the Hotel and Spa do Vinho retreat in Brazil among recent additions to the portfolio.
